Cushman & Wakefield in Christchurch is seeking a maintenance technician to perform reactive maintenance and small projects, and to assist with Planned Preventative Maintenance. You will be part of a diverse trades team based at Paragon Place, serving major NZ clients including banks, government agencies and universities.
The role requires HVAC trade qualifications, strong health and safety commitment, and excellent English. Training and a supportive benefits program are provided.
